/* CSS Document - Common */
/* Created by Dale Brodie - June 2004, updated July 22, 2004 */
/* Revised by Eric Wakida - 03.23.06 */

body, html{
height:auto;
}

h5.profileTitle, h5.sectionheader2, h5.hdr_keyset, #productioninfo, h5.comingsoon{
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 9px;
	font-weight: normal;
	color: #000000;
	text-align:left;
	padding:0px;
 margin:0px;
}


body {
	background: url(css_images/bkg_slice_775.gif) repeat-y;
	background-position:center;
	background-color: #f0f0f0;
	padding: 0px;
	margin: 0px;	
}

/* global links */

a:hover, a:active {
	color: #036;
	text-decoration: underline;
}
a:link, a:visited {
	color: #333333;
	text-decoration: none;
}
h5.profileTitle {
	background-image: url(css_images/blend_e9e9e9.gif);
	background-repeat: repeat-x;
	background-position: bottom;
	width:714px;
	font-size: 18px;
	font-weight: bold;
	padding: 0px 7px 5px 7px;
	margin:4px 0px 0px 0px;
	font-variant: normal;
	letter-spacing: -1px;
	text-transform: uppercase;
	float:left;
}
.profileTable {
 float:left;
 width:728px;
 height:auto;
 clear:both;
	background-color: #F9F9F9;
	background-image: url(css_images/blend_e9tof9.jpg);
	background-repeat: repeat-x;
	background-position: bottom;
	border: 1px solid #BCBCC6;
	padding:0px;
}

h5.subHead {
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#D9D9D9;
	text-align:left;
	margin:0px 0px 10px 0px;
	padding:0px;
}
.sectionHeader {
	font-size: 11px;
	font-weight: bold;
}

.trailerLinksBorder {
	border: 1px solid #C0C0CA;
	background-color: #f0f0f0;
}


/* Structure */
#header {
height:89px;
padding:0px;
margin:0px;
}


#profilePic {
 width:135px;
	padding:10px 10px 10px 10px;
	float:left;
	clear:both;
}

#contentTable {
	width: 552px;
	margin: 0px;
	padding: 10px 10px 0px 10px;
	float:left;
	border-width: 0px 0px 0px 1px;
	border-style: solid;
	border-color: #CCCCCC;
}

#holder{
width:730px;
height:auto;
padding:0px 10px 0px 10px;
position:relative;
}


#contentTable a:link, #contentTable a:visited, #sidebar a:link, #sidebar a:visited {
	color:#333333;
	text-decoration: none;
}
#contentTable a:hover, #contentTable a:active, #sidebar a:active, #sidebar a:hover {
	color: #036;
	text-decoration: underline;
}


#footer {
 width:700px;
 height:20px;
	padding:5px;
float:left;
	text-align: center;
}

.keysetholder {
	height: 54px;
	width: 100%;
 margin-bottom:14px;
	text-align:left;
}

.thmbpic3{
border: 1px solid #666666;
float:left;
margin:0px 9px 0px 0px;
}

.kaoborder{
border: 1px solid #666666;
}

h5.hdr_keyset, h5.sectionheader2{
font-size:11px;
font-weight:bold;
}

#productioninfo{
  margin:10px 0px 0px 10px;
	 padding-bottom:10px;
	 width: auto;
		height:auto;
		text-align:left;
}

#productioninfo ul {
	padding-left: 2px;
	list-style-type: none;
	margin: 0px 0px 10px 0px;
}
#productioninfo li {
	background-image: url(css_images/graphic_arrow_r.gif);
	background-repeat: no-repeat;
	background-position: 0em 0.5em;
	padding-left: 0.6em;
}
#productioninfo a {}
#productioninfo a:link, #subnavNoteslist a:visited {
	color: #000000;
	text-decoration: none;
}
#productioninfo a:hover {
	color: #036;
	text-decoration: underline;
}

h5.comingsoon {
	font-size: 11px;
	font-weight: bold;
	padding: 0px 0px 50px 10px;
}

.websitebtn {
margin:10px 0px 4px 0px;
}

.comingsoon{
font-weight:bold;
font-size:12px;
padding:0px 0px 100px 10px;
text-align:left;
}